The Evolution of Vacuum Cleaners
Vacuum cleaners have come a long method given that their inception in the early 1900s. Conventional designs required manual operation, which frequently included carrying around heavy equipment and handling cumbersome cords. The introduction of electrical models produced increased suction power and benefit, however the true revolution began with the development of robotic and smart vacuum.
Secret Milestones in Vacuum Evolution:1901: The first powered vacuum cleaner was invented by Hubert Cecil Booth.1937: The first cylinder vacuum was produced by Electrolux.1986: The launching of the first robotic vacuum, 'Electrolux's Trilobite'.2002: iRobot released Roomba, setting the stage for automated floor cleaning.
The rise of smart technology has actually further boosted customer expectations, leading to the advancement of vacuum cleaners geared up with expert system (AI), smart devices, and sensing units that enable for self-governing operation.

Considerations Before Purchasing
While smart vacuum cleaners offer many benefits, there are factors potential buyers need to think about:
Price Point: Smart vacuums are generally more costly than traditional models. Budget and features need to align with homeowner requirements.
Home Layout: Complex layouts with heavy furniture or special layout may pose navigation difficulties.
Maintenance: Regular cleaning of the vacuum itself is necessary for optimal performance.
Battery Life: Consider the battery period of a robotic vacuum, especially for bigger homes. Some models might deal with long cleaning times.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I keep my smart vacuum?
To keep a smart vacuum:
Regularly empty the dust container.Tidy brushes and filters periodically.Keep sensing units free of dirt and obstruction to ensure effective navigation.
2. Can I use a smart vacuum on carpets?
Yes, a lot of smart vacuum cleaners are developed to effectively clean carpets, hardwood floorings, and tiles. Higher-end designs even have settings to adjust suction power for various surface areas.
3. Are smart vacuum cleaners noisy?
While noise levels differ by brand and model, most modern smart vacuums have reduced their sound levels compared to standard vacuums. Lots of users report that they can clean up throughout the night without troubling household members.
4. Can I control my smart vacuum with my smart device?
Yes, a lot of smart vacuum feature associated smart device apps that enable users to manage cleaning schedules, start/stop cleaning, and view cleaning logs.
5. Do smart vacuums go back to their charging station automatically?
Yes, the majority of smart vacuums have self-charging capabilities and will instantly go back to their charging dock when the battery runs low or after finishing a cleaning session.
